This matter comes before
the Board upon
an October
2,
1986,
petition
for variance filed on behalf of Deere
& Company.
That
petition is deficient
in that it fails to
include
a plan
for
compliance during
the term of variance pursuant
to 35 Ill.
Adm.
Code 104.121(f).
While
the petition does contain
an allegation
that site—specific relief will
be requested,
that does not
constitute
a sufficient plan.
Unless and amended petition
is
filed within 45 days of the
date of this Order curing
the above—noted defects,
this matter
will
be subject to dismissal.
IT
IS SO ORDERED.
